  • Project 2000 Lift Bed system full installation process.
    This is a guide as to how we installed our electric lift bed in our VW Crafter Campervan conversion. (Same as Happi Jack lift bed).
    This isn't manufacturers installation but how we have chosen to install the system in our campervan. It creates a MWB Crafter which sleeps 4 and maintains the space when the bed is not in use.

    Nice solution! I just built in this liftbed myself. I have one small issue. Maybe you know this? You can change the max ascent and descent. I solved ascent (+ is higher max - is lower max). But I can't get max descent set up. Is - lower minimum or less low minimum?

    • @recraftedcampers4686
      @recraftedcampers4686  2 ปีที่แล้ว +1

      Hi Jan
      A very good question 😊
      I gave up on adjusting it, just do it manually.
      I do need to go back and do it again at some point.

    • @janpietervandenheuvel5784
      @janpietervandenheuvel5784 2 ปีที่แล้ว

      @@recraftedcampers4686 I got the answer from lippert, + is more strokes - is less strokes. I had to do a lot of - turns before I got there, but finally found it. I hope it helps you. I already blew a fuse, when going up, so an automated stop is nice.
